problem with my site..
I notice and friends tell me that if they enter one of my galleries or cattegories from the homepage they find it difficult to navigate back to the main page (hope that makes sense). Is there anyway of having a button that always returns to the index of my galleries?

You already have that, although maybe your viewers don't know to use it.

Clicking on the first entry in the breadcrumb returns the viewers to your home page.

An alternative would be to add something like this to your gallery descriptions:
Code:
 
<html>
Click <a href="http://ightenhill.smugmug.com">here</a> to return to my home page.
</html>
